Summary
Overview
Work History
Education
Skills
Timeline
Generic
ISLAM SANAYATOV

ISLAM SANAYATOV

Senior Backend Software Engineer (Java / Kotlin)
Almaty

Summary

Highly skilled software engineer with over 7 years of experience in developing and designing software solutions. Proficient in multiple programming languages and frameworks including Java, Kotlin, Spring. Proven ability to effectively lead and collaborate with teams to deliver innovative software projects on time and within budget. Excellent problem-solving skills to identify issues and provide timely resolutions. Passionate about implementing best practices and continuously learning new technologies to deliver top-notch products.

Overview

9
9
years of professional experience
2
2
Languages

Work History

Senior Software Engineer

Alfabank
06.2022 - Current
  • Developed and maintained software in multiple programming languages, such as Java, Kotlin
  • Designed, coded, tested, and deployed new UI features and systems using CI/CD best practices.
  • Enhanced software functionality by identifying and resolving complex technical issues.
  • Implemented a microservices architecture that improved system modularity and reduced dependencies between components
  • Developed reusable components that significantly reduced development effort on multiple projects.

Senior Software Engineer

Politico
05.2021 - 06.2022
  • Developed and maintained REST APIs that enabled integration with multiple third-party providers
  • Translated business requirements and functional specifications into logical program designs, code modules, and stable application systems.
  • Developed unit tests to ensure code quality and ensure compliance with software development best practices
  • Supported, maintained, documented, and enhanced software functionality.
  • Developed scalable applications using agile methodologies for timely project delivery.

Senior Software Engineer/Team Leader

BTS Digital
04.2018 - 05.2021
  • Maintaining and developing bot services for our own instant messaging service AITU. Integration with bot platform in kotlin using coroutines.
  • Facilitated implementation and maintenance of software solutions to support successful deployment.
  • Helped with peer-to-peer code reviews, project planning, and timeline estimations for project development.
  • Supervised programmers, designers, and other department personnel, including task delegation.
  • Utilized Spring MVC to develop a web application that supported user authentication, authorization and session management
  • Developed scalable and maintainable code, ensuring long-term stability of the software.
  • Integrated new technologies into existing systems, increasing capabilities and improving overall performance.

Software Engineer

KCELL
09.2017 - 04.2018
  • Verified compliance with customer needs by testing software functionality and equipment load capabilities.
  • Drafted software requirements and managed software design and implementation

Java Developer

Khan Group
09.2016 - 09.2017
  • Adapted existing software to new purposes, improving performance and including new functionality.
  • Developed intuitive, easy-to-navigate, and aesthetically pleasing user interfaces.

Education

Bachelor - Information System

International IT University
Almaty
06.2016

Skills

Java

Timeline

Senior Software Engineer

Alfabank
06.2022 - Current

Senior Software Engineer

Politico
05.2021 - 06.2022

Senior Software Engineer/Team Leader

BTS Digital
04.2018 - 05.2021

Software Engineer

KCELL
09.2017 - 04.2018

Java Developer

Khan Group
09.2016 - 09.2017

Bachelor - Information System

International IT University
ISLAM SANAYATOVSenior Backend Software Engineer (Java / Kotlin)